Obama sends condolences after Israeli teenager deaths


(MENAFN- Kuwait News Agency (KUNA)) President Barack Obama extended "deepest and heartfelt condolences" Monday to the families of the three teenagers Eyal Yifrach, Gil'ad Shaar, and Naftali Fraenkel who were kidnapped and found dea



Obama said in a statement, "As a father, I cannot imagine the indescribable pain that the parents of these teenage boys are experiencing." The US "condemns in the strongest possible terms this senseless act of terror against innocent youth," Obama affirme



The three boys also had Israeli and American citizenshi



He added, "From the outset, I have offered our full support to Israel and the Palestinian Authority to find the perpetrators of this crime and bring them to justice, and I encourage Israel and the Palestinian Authority to continue working together in that effor



"I also urge all parties to refrain from steps that could further destabilize the situation," affirmed Obama
